2 Timothy 3:15 - Hebrew Names version (HNV)

15 From infancy, you have known the sacred writings which are able to make you wise for salvation through faith, which is in Messiah Yeshua.

King James Version (Oxford) 1769

15 and that from a child thou hast known the holy scriptures, which are able to make thee wise unto salvation through faith which is in Christ Jesus.

Amplified Bible - Classic Edition

15 And how from your childhood you have had a knowledge of and been acquainted with the sacred Writings, which are able to instruct you and give you the understanding for salvation which comes through faith in Christ Jesus [through the leaning of the entire human personality on God in Christ Jesus in absolute trust and confidence in His power, wisdom, and goodness].
